Palace cut down to size by Blades

August 18 2019

Crystal Palace put in an abject performance to lose 1-0 at Sheffield United.

The newly-promoted Blades were far more committed than Roy Hodgson's side who were toothless in attack.

United should have taken the lead in the opening period when David McGoldrick's shot from close range was saved by keeper Vicente Guaita after an error by Patrick van Aanholt.

But they went ahead in a scrappy game two minutes after the break when Guaita's excellent sprawling save from Luke Freeman fell into the path of John Lundstram who lashed into the back of the net.

Palace failed to respond for the rest of the half and were totally devoid of ideas against a side that many tip to get relegated.

Palace: Guaita, Ward, Dann, Kelly, Van Aanholt, Meyer (Schlupp 64), Milivojevic, McArthur (Wickham 82), Zaha, Townsend (McCarthy 70), Benteke.

Not Used: Hennessey, Kouyate, Ayew, Cahill.

Sheffield Utd: Henderson, O’Connell, Egan, Basham, Stevens, Fleck (Freeman 28), Norwood, Lundstram, Baldock, McGoldrick (Jagielka 89), Robinson (McBurnie 55).

Not Used: Sharp, Osborn, Moore, Besic.
